Abbott glucose test strips recall at Naval Health Clinic Charleston

By Naval Health Clinic Charleston Public Affairs

Based on recommendations from the U.S. Food and Drug Administration issued on Dec. 22, 2010, Naval Health Clinic Charleston is recalling different lots of Abbot Diabetes Care glucose test strips.

According to the FDA, the test strips being recalled may give falsely low blood glucose results. False results may lead patients to try to raise their blood glucose unnecessarily, or they may fail to treat elevated blood glucose because of a false, low reading. Both scenarios pose risks to a patient's health.

The test strips are marketed under the following brand names, specifically the Precision Xtra Blood Glucose Test Strips; Precision Xceed Pro; Precision Xtra; Medisense Optium; Optium; OptiumEZ; and ReliOn Ultima. The test strips are used with Abbott's Precision Xtra, Precision Xceed Pro, MediSense Optium, Optium, Optium EZ and ReliOn Ultima blood glucose monitoring systems. As many as 359 million strips may be affected by the recall. The blood glucose monitoring systems are not affected by this recall.

The FDA, working with Abbot Diabetes Care, notes that the recall is related to the test strips' inability to absorb enough blood for monitoring. Strips exposed to warm weather or prolonged storage may be more likely to provide a false result. The test strips were manufactured between January and September 2010 and are sold both in retail and online settings directly to consumers, but are also used in health care facilities.

If the test stripes have been stored in 86 degrees F or higher they are most likely defective because the heat affects a portion of the strip that determines the actual glucose reading.

If it takes longer than five seconds to get a reading once the blood hits the strip while in the meter, the strip is defective, most likely due to excessive heat. If it takes less than five seconds, there should not be an issue and use of the strips is acceptable.

Patients who have received test strips are encouraged to check the list of lot numbers below, or call NHCC Pharmacy at 794-6100 for clarification. If any patient has stored any test strips on the list in 86 degrees Fahrenheit heat or higher, please return to the pharmacy for replacement. If it takes longer than five seconds to get a reading, and the test strips are on the list, return to the pharmacy.

Additionally, patients can call Abbott Diabetes Care customer service at 1-800-448-5234 (English) and 1-800-709-7010 (Spanish) to speak with a customer service representative.
